Easy (somewhat) Intro to the Pali Canon

      There is no getting around it - the Pali Canon is long and difficult to read.  It is also something that you need to read if you truly want to understand Buddhism.  The Pali Canon are the actual words of ther Buddha.  His closest disciples and many of the great scholars got together and committed it all to paper. 
      This is not the easiest read, but it is much easier than working through the 80+ volumes of the Tripitaka.
